Molly Wardaguga Research Centre/Birthing on Country
Contacts21 February 2025 - The Molly Wardaguga Research Centre began in April 2019. It is dedicated to the late Molly Wardaguga, Burarra Elder, Aboriginal midwife, senior Aboriginal health worker and founding member of the Malabam Health Board in Maningrida, Arnhem Land.
